Premier Oil Reports Record Profits, Achieves Strongest Ever Financial Position

Premier Oil, a leading FTSE 250 independent exploration and production company, has reported its record after-tax profits of US$171.2 million for the year ending December 31, 2011, up from US$129.8 million in 2010. Operating cash flows increased by 11.4 per cent to US$485.9 million, up from US$436.0 million in 2010.

Ted Baker Delivers Strong FY Performance, Plans Rapid International Expansion

Ted baker, the British designer brand, has reported a rise of 14.9 percent in its revenues for the year ended January 28, 2012 at £215.6 million, compared to £187.7 million in the previous year. The group's profit before tax increased by 0.1 percent to £24.3 million and basic earnings per share rose by 1.7 percent to 42.2 pence.

Cairn Energy Posts Record FY Profits

Cairn Energy, the independent oil, gas exploration and production company has reported a record profit after tax of $4.6 billion for the year ended 31 December, 2011 with a cash balance of $4.7 billion.

Brady Posts Robust FY Earnings

Brady, a commodity risk management software provider, has reported a rise of 72 per cent in its full year revenue to £19.16 million, up from £11.12 million in 2010, including an increase in recurring revenues of 147 per cent to £9.79 million.
